Spotlight: Angela Stanford
Angela Stanford recorded her second win of the 2008 LPGA Tour season with her victory at the inaugural Lorena Ochoa Invitational at the Guadalajara Country Club in Mexico. Spotlight: Carl Pettersson
Carl Pettersson won the Wyndham Championship for his first trophy in two years. The host venue Sedgefield Country Club is somewhat a home away from home as Pettersson serves on the board of directors. Spotlight: Katherine Hull
Fifth-year pro Katherine Hull grabbed her first LPGA Tour trophy at the CN Canadian Women’s Open at the Ottawa Hunt and Golf Club, coming back from six strokes on the final day. Spotlight: Vijay Singh
Vijay Singh captured his first World Golf Championship trophy at the Bridgestone Invitational and became the oldest WGC champion in the events history. Marking his 32nd career win, Singh becomes the PGA Tours career wins leader among international players. This season, Singh has five top five finishes. Spotlight: Stewart Cink
Stewart Cink reached the winners circle for the first time since 2004 with a one-shot victory at the Travelers Championship in Connecticut. Spotlight: Justin Leonard
Justin Leonard claimed his first victory of the 2008 PGA Tour season at the Stanford St. Jude Championship, beating Trevor Immelman and Robert Allenby on the second hole of a sudden death playoff.
